FAQ — New Starters, Quillstone Systems. Q: What do I need for a data-centre cage visit at the Harwick facility? A: Book the visit through your team lead at least 48 hours ahead. Bring your staff badge and photo ID; bags go in the lockers outside the cage corridor. An escort from the DC team meets you at the mantrap. Your booking confirmation includes the visit reference and the cage access code below.

staff pass of kawip-hawef = bdg-QLP-2

Before shipping a Pondermill release, double-check the date localization pass. Our formatter pulls locale rules from the Calyxa bundle, so if someone added a new region (looking at you, Westbrine pilot), rerun the locale sync script and eyeball a few rendered dates — month-first versus day-first mixups are our most common bug report. Commit the regenerated bundles, then tag the release. The tag won't be accepted by the publishing pipeline unless it's signed, so use the release signing key that follows.

deploy key for kajof-fajop: bky6_gDHw9Q

Finance Review Summary — Training Budget, Next Fiscal Year

Prepared for the heads of department. The proposed training allocation rises eight percent, driven mainly by the Larkspur certification program and expanded onboarding at the Dunmere site. Travel-linked training is trimmed in favor of facilitated remote cohorts. Department caps remain unchanged pending the December review. Please weigh your requests against the strategic direction noted confidentially below.

confidential, tagep-yahag: Headcount on the Oliael team goes from 5 to 100 by the end of July. Gross margin on Oliael came in at 20 percent against a plan of 15 percent.

Hi support folks! RotoVault is our internal tool that swaps service credentials on a schedule, so you'll mostly see it mentioned in tickets about expired tokens. If you need to reproduce an issue locally, the setup is quick: clone the repo, copy `env.sample` to `.env`, and leave the defaults alone. The only thing you have to fill in is the admin credential for the Quillhaven vault backend. Add this line to your `.env`:

sealed setting: VAULT_KEY20=c8ea1e419912889df6b4